Abstract
The terrible tsunami disaster, on 26 December 2004 hit Krabi, one of the ecotourist and very fascinating
provinces of southern Thailand including its various regions e.g. Phangna and Phuket by devastating
the human lives, coastal communications and the financially viable activities. This research study has
been aimed to generate the tsunami hazard preventing based lands use planning model using GIS
(Geographical Information Systems) based on the hazard suitability analysis approach. The different
triggering factors e.g. elevation, proximity to shore line, population density, mangrove, forest, stream
and road have been used based on the land use zoning criteria. Those criteria have been used by using
Saaty scale of importance one, of the mathematical techniques. This model has been classified according
to the land suitability classification. The various techniques of GIS, namely subsetting, spatial analysis,
map difference and data conversion have been used. The model has been generated with five categories
such as high, moderate, low, very low and not suitable regions illustrating with their appropriate definition
for the decision makers to redevelop the region.
